The Endless Maze: Escaping the Trap of Perpetual Work

In our society, we're often sold the idea that hard work is the key to success and satisfaction. But what if this promise is just a mirage in an endless maze? A maze where the more we work, the more work there seems to be, leaving us running in circles, always chasing but never quite reaching that elusive sense of accomplishment.
Consider this scenario: A young professional climbs the ladder from an apprenticeship earning £3.85 an hour to a position just above minimum wage. On paper, it looks like progress. But the reality? They're trapped in a maze of constant financial stress, struggling to afford a small house in an affordable area, with no vacation in over a decade.
You might think, "But they're doing better than most." And therein lies the cruel irony of our current system. We've normalized a reality where even those in "good" jobs are struggling, where the prospect of advancement comes with an unspoken caveat - dedicate your entire life to your work, only to find more work waiting around the next corner.
Professional exams, for instance, aren't just testing knowledge or skill. They're testing how much of your personal life you're willing to sacrifice in this maze. Evenings, weekends, hobbies - all consumed by the never-ending pursuit of the next checkpoint, the next promotion, the next payrise. But does reaching these checkpoints ever truly bring satisfaction? Or does it just reveal another stretch of the maze, with even more demanding challenges?
We need to challenge this narrative. A fulfilling life shouldn't be an endless series of work-related goals, each accomplished only to reveal more work. We all deserve time for hobbies, exploration, and fun. These aren't luxuries; they're essential waypoints in the maze of life, offering moments of genuine satisfaction and growth.
By accepting a system where we're expected to dedicate our whole lives to our jobs, always chasing the next target, we're not just harming ourselves. We're perpetuating a cycle that affects everyone, from those in professional careers to those on minimum wage or benefits. We're all running in this maze, some with more obstacles than others, but all of us struggling to find the exit to true satisfaction.
It's time we valued ourselves beyond our productivity. It's time we demanded a life outside of this work maze. Because if those in "good" jobs are struggling to find balance and satisfaction, imagine the pressure on those with fewer resources.
We need to redefine success. It shouldn't be about how far we can run in this endless maze of work, but about how well we can live, how much joy we can find in the journey. It's not about complaining - it's about recognizing that the current system is unsustainable for most of us, trapping us in a cycle of perpetual work without true fulfillment.
Let's start a conversation about escaping this maze. About valuing our time, our hobbies, our personal growth. About finding satisfaction not in endless work, but in the richness of a life well-lived. Because a society that only values us for our ability to navigate an endless work maze is a society that's lost sight of what truly matters.
It's time to stop running and start living. The real satisfaction isn't at the end of the maze - it's in choosing to step off the prescribed path and create our own.

Hi! I really enjoy your page, and was wondering if you had this experience or knew of a similar one. I (6months ago) recently came out of a depressive state and got a new job, started doing lipstick and mascara and perfume before work and just adjusting little things, adding a skincare routine, going to the gym, and I feel really good! But the only downside is I feel like I’m literally beating subpar men off with a stick, but not the kind of men you’d WANT chasing you around (not that I want any but if they’re gonna…) it’s so infuriating and I don’t wanna be a bitch at work but they won’t GO AWAY and it makes my work very inefficient and harder to do. Is there a way to still be polite and friendly while making the lines clear or will I just have to be mean for a while?
Hi love. I'm sorry that you're having to deal with this unfortunate repercussion of society and social dynamics under patriarchy.
It is not "being mean" to be assertive, maintain clear boundaries, and only present yourself with direct, professional communication at work. No one deserves to "see you smile" or have you entertain their inappropriate advances.
Just don't be accommodating to their flirtatious attention. Personally, if it were just stares or overly kind conversations/gestures, nothing sexual or overtly inappropriate, I would ignore it and communicate like you don't notice. Keep it brief, professional, and emotionally neutral. Any smart man would get the message and back off if they don't want to have to switch departments or jobs.
Best of luck, stay strong! Hope this helps xx

9 benefits of Wellness programs in the workplace
Introduction:
In the fast-paced corporate landscape, where deadlines loom large and stress levels soar, the significance of employee well-being cannot be overstated. The implementation of workplace wellness programs has emerged as a pivotal strategy for organizations striving to create a conducive and health-centric work environment. From boosting morale to enhancing productivity, these programs offer a myriad of advantages that go beyond the traditional employer-employee relationship. Let’s delve into the 9 key benefits of workplace wellness programs.
1. Improved Physical Health: Workplace wellness programs are designed to encourage and support healthier lifestyle choices. Fitness challenges, nutritional counseling, and preventive health screenings are often integral components. Employees who participate in these programs are more likely to adopt healthier habits, leading to a reduction in the risk of chronic diseases and improved overall physical health.
2. Enhanced Mental Well-being: Mental health is an integral aspect of overall well-being, and workplace wellness programs recognize its significance. Activities such as stress management workshops, meditation sessions, and counseling services contribute to a more supportive and positive work environment. As employees gain tools to manage stress and prioritize mental health, the overall workplace atmosphere becomes more conducive to sustained productivity.
3. Increased Productivity: Employee efficiency increases when they are in good physical and mental health. Wellness programs contribute to increased energy levels, reduced absenteeism, and improved concentration. By fostering a healthy work environment, organizations can create a culture that values employee well-being, ultimately boosting individual and collective productivity.
4. Enhanced Employee Morale: Workplace wellness programs are a tangible way for employers to demonstrate their commitment to the well-being of their staff. As employees witness the organization investing in their health and happiness, it fosters a sense of appreciation and loyalty. This, in turn, leads to higher morale and a more positive workplace culture.
5. Better Employee Engagement: Employee engagement is a critical factor in organizational success. Wellness programs provide opportunities for team-building activities, fostering a sense of community among colleagues. Whether through fitness challenges, health-related workshops, or group activities, these programs create shared experiences that contribute to stronger bonds among team members.
6. Attraction and Retention of Talent: Attracting and keeping the best employees in the competitive job market is a never-ending struggle. Workplace wellness programs can set an organization apart as a desirable employer. Prospective employees are increasingly valuing companies that prioritize their well-being. Moreover, existing staff are more likely to stay with an employer who actively supports their health and work-life balance.
7. Cost Savings for Employers: While the initial investment in workplace wellness programs may seem significant, the long-term cost savings can be substantial. By preventing chronic illnesses, reducing absenteeism, and improving overall employee health, organizations can mitigate healthcare costs. A healthier workforce is a more cost-effective one in the long run.
8. Positive Impact on Company Culture: Workplace wellness programs play a pivotal role in shaping the company’s culture. Organizations that prioritize employee well-being communicate a clear message about their values. This commitment resonates throughout the workplace, creating a culture where health and wellness are integral components of the company ethos.
9. Regulated Stress Levels: Workplace stress is a common concern that can lead to burnout and decreased job satisfaction. Wellness programs often include stress management initiatives, providing employees with tools to cope with the demands of their roles. By regulating stress levels, organizations can create an environment where employees feel supported and equipped to manage work-related pressures effectively.

Spill the Tea: What’s the Difference Between "Cleaning" and "Janitorial Services"?
This is the number one question people have. You might think, "We have someone who tidies up. Isn't that enough?" Not quite. Think of it like this:
Regular Cleaning: This is often a one-off or periodic job. Think of a deep spring clean, post-construction cleanup, or getting the carpets shampooed once a year. It’s intensive and project-based.
Commercial Janitorial Services: This is the ongoing, holistic care of your entire facility. It’s a managed program of daily, weekly, and monthly tasks designed to maintain a consistent state of cleanliness, hygiene, and order. It’s not just about making things look clean; it’s about keeping them fundamentally healthy and well-maintained over the long term.
A janitorial team becomes part of your operational rhythm. They are the pros who handle the day-in, day-out work that keeps your business from slowly descending into a state of grimy chaos. They tackle everything from the routine to the specialized, ensuring your workspace isn't just clean for a day, but stays that way always.
The Nitty-Gritty: What’s Actually on the Janitorial Checklist?
So what does this look like in practice? A professional janitorial plan is customized, but it generally covers a comprehensive list of tasks that you and your team probably don't have the time (or desire) to do.
🧼 General Workspaces (Offices, Cubicles, Conference Rooms)
This is where your team spends most of their time, and where dust and germs love to party.
Daily: Dusting all surfaces (desks, shelves, picture frames), wiping down high-touch points (light switches, door handles), emptying individual trash bins, and spot-cleaning glass.
Weekly: Thoroughly vacuuming all carpets, including under desks; sweeping and mopping hard floors; and polishing any interior glass or metal fixtures.
🚽 The "Oh-No" Zones (Restrooms & Breakrooms)
These areas are make-or-break for employee morale and visitor impressions. There’s no cutting corners here.
Daily: Complete disinfection of all fixtures (toilets, urinals, sinks, faucets). Wiping down countertops, stall doors, and partitions. Cleaning mirrors until they are streak-free. Restocking all supplies like toilet paper, paper towels, and hand soap. Emptying all trash receptacles. Sweeping and mopping/disinfecting floors.
Breakroom/Kitchen: Wiping and sanitizing countertops and tables. Cleaning the exterior of appliances (microwave, refrigerator). Cleaning the inside of the microwave (this is a big one!). Washing out the sink.
🚶♀️ High-Traffic Zones (Lobbies, Hallways, Entryways)
This is your business’s first impression. It needs to be flawless.
Daily: Cleaning glass entrance doors. Sweeping and mopping hard floors to remove tracked-in dirt and debris. Vacuuming mats and carpets. Tidying up any reception or waiting area furniture.
✨ Pro-Level Floor Care
This is where professionals truly shine (pun intended). Your floors are a massive investment, and proper care extends their life dramatically.
Routine: Daily sweeping and mopping isn’t just for looks; it prevents the fine grit and dirt from acting like sandpaper and scratching your flooring over time.
Periodic: This can include machine scrubbing of tile and grout, high-speed burnishing or buffing to restore shine to VCT or waxed floors, and interim carpet cleaning to lift dirt from high-traffic lanes before it gets ground in.
The Glow-Up is Real: Benefits You Didn't Even Expect
Okay, so the place will be clean. But the real ROI from professional commercial janitorial services goes so much deeper than just a shiny floor.
A Major Boost to Health & Morale: Let's be real. Nobody wants to work in a grimy office. A professionally cleaned space shows your employees you value their well-being. Proper disinfection drastically reduces the spread of germs, meaning fewer sick days for your team. A clean, fresh-smelling environment is a proven morale booster.
That Killer First Impression: You never get a second chance to make a first impression. When a potential client, new hire, or important partner walks into your facility, a spotless environment subconsciously tells them you are professional, detail-oriented, and successful. A dirty bathroom or dusty lobby can instantly undermine your credibility.
Protecting Your Biggest Assets: You’ve spent thousands, maybe millions, on your facility and everything in it. Professional janitorial services are a form of asset protection. Proper floor care prevents premature replacement. Regular dusting protects electronics from damaging particle buildup. Maintaining the building prevents small issues from becoming costly repairs.
Unlocking Productivity and Focus: A cluttered, dirty environment is a distracting environment. When your team isn’t worried about the overflowing trash or a sticky breakroom counter, they can better focus on their actual jobs. A clean, organized space promotes a clear, organized mind.
The Pro Toolkit: Why Your Team Can’t Just "Do It Themselves"
You might be tempted to just create a cleaning roster for your staff. But a professional service brings an arsenal of equipment, knowledge, and efficiency that simply can't be matched in-house.
The Equipment: They use industrial-grade tools that are more powerful and effective. This includes HEPA-filter vacuums that trap allergens, high-speed floor burnishers that create a hardened, durable shine, and automatic scrubbers that can clean large floors perfectly in minutes.
The Supplies: Professionals use commercial-grade, concentrated disinfectants and cleaning agents that are more effective than store-bought products. They understand things like "dwell time"—the amount of time a disinfectant needs to sit on a surface to actually kill germs.
The Knowledge: This is the most important part. They are trained in safety protocols, like understanding Safety Data Sheets (SDS) for all chemicals. They use methods like color-coded microfiber systems to prevent cross-contamination (i.e., the cloth used in the bathroom is never used in the kitchen).

Who Is a Mental Health Technician?
A mental health technician is a trained professional who provides direct care and support to individuals experiencing mental health conditions. They work under the supervision of a qualified mental health professional, such as a psychiatrist, psychologist, or licensed therapist, in settings like hospitals, long-term mental health facilities, and mental health outpatient programs. Their role is multifaceted, combining compassionate care with practical assistance to promote recovery and well-being.
Mental health technicians assist with daily activities, monitor patient progress, and ensure a safe and supportive environment. They are often the bridge between patients and clinical staff, offering emotional support and facilitating therapeutic interventions. As one poignant quote about mental health states, “You don’t have to be positive all the time. It’s perfectly okay to feel sad, angry, annoyed, frustrated, scared, or anxious. Having feelings doesn’t make you a negative person. It makes you human.” — Lori Deschene. This perspective underscores the technician’s role in validating patients’ emotions while guiding them toward healing.
Key Responsibilities of a Mental Health Technician
Mental health technicians are integral to the care team, performing tasks that nurture the body, mind, and spirit of their clients. Their responsibilities include:
Patient Monitoring: Observing and documenting patients’ behavior, mood, and progress to provide insights to the treatment team.
Daily Support: Assisting with activities of daily living, such as personal hygiene, meals, and medication adherence, particularly in long-term mental health facilities.
Crisis Intervention: Responding calmly and effectively to crises, ensuring patient safety and de-escalating situations when needed.
Therapeutic Support: Facilitating group activities, recreational therapy, or coping skills sessions in mental health outpatient programs.
Collaboration: Working closely with a qualified mental health professional to implement treatment plans and provide feedback on patient progress.
By addressing both physical and emotional needs, mental health technicians help create a holistic healing environment. The Importance of Mental Health Technicians in Long-Term Facilities
In long-term mental health facilities, mental health technicians are often the backbone of patient care. These facilities cater to individuals with chronic mental health conditions, such as schizophrenia, bipolar disorder, or severe depression, who require extended support. Technicians in these settings provide consistent care, build trust with patients, and help implement long-term treatment plans.
Their role is particularly crucial in fostering a sense of community and stability. For example, they may lead group therapy sessions, encourage social interaction, or assist with vocational training to prepare patients for reintegration into society. Qualifications and Training for Mental Health Technicians
Becoming a mental health technician typically requires a high school diploma, though many employers prefer candidates with an associate’s or bachelor’s degree in psychology, social work, or a related field. Certification programs, such as those offered by the American Association of Psychiatric Technicians, provide specialized training in mental health care. Additionally, technicians must possess strong interpersonal skills, empathy, and the ability to remain calm under pressure.
Working alongside a qualified mental health professional, technicians gain hands-on experience that enhances their ability to support patients effectively.
